* Two adjustable paper trays/built-in auto 2-sided printing
* Preview corrected photo on LCD before printing
* View, select, crop, rotate and enlarge with 2.5", tilt LCD
* Use memory card slots to print photos PC-free
* Print directly onto ink jet printable CDs/DVDs
* Restore old, faded color photos ? PC-free
* Scan to PDF for e-mailing or archiving ? PC-Free
* Six individual ink cartridges

Yeah it's an awesome trick. ALSO, you can generate a Multi-Use card if you want to use it on say Newegg every time you order. My only complaint is that they left out a key feature - you can't name the credit card! (like "Newegg" card or something). So I mostly stick with single-use cards. They also have an actual browser plugin that you can download that will generate numbers on the fly. I was on the beta program for it and I don't think they've done a good enough job advertising it - it's sitting there in plain site and yet no one knows about it haha. Their browser plugin also keeps tracks of receipts and stuff, it's REALLY handy.

Personally I only have 3 things that touch my bank account: my Paypal account, my Credit Card, and my ING Account. In real life, I only use a Credit Card for purchases, just in case the number is ever stolen. My Debit Card number was stolen not once, but twice, and it was a real pain in the neck getting the bank to deal with it, whereas Credit Card companies are used to it and even have alarm systems that trigger if your card is being used in a funny way, like multiple purchases halfway across the nation from where you live. Then only, I only use Paypal, and if Paypal isn't an option, I use the Secure Cards checkout. And finally ING for my computer savings account.
